Wastewater Reuse And Recycling Today
Source: Schreiber
The wastewater reuse segment of the water industry has experienced both rapid growth and tremendous change over the last several years. The global demand for increased water supplies has fueled the development of alternative water sources, including the use of reclaimed wastewater. A 2012 study by the National Science Foundation states that US coastal cities could increase their water supplies by 27 percent with treated wastewater. The demand for water supply in the future will be even greater, due to population growth and other demographic factors.
